

Siuwa Monyei is a dual-qualified lawyer and child digital rights expert with over a decade of legal experience. At Chronicles Advisory, she advises clients on corporate and commercial matters and arbitration and alternative dispute resolution (ADR).
Siuwa has extensive experience in arbitration and dispute resolution, having coordinated arbitral proceedings, served as tribunal secretary, and acted as both counsel and mediator in mediation proceedings. She is also actively involved in sustainable legal education initiatives, co-leading practice teams focused on developing innovative learning and professional development solutions for emerging legal practitioners. Her work includes contributing to the drafting of the African Arbitration Association Guidelines and Standards.
Siuwa is called to the Bar in Nigeria and is also qualified in England and Wales. She holds advanced degrees in law and political economy, including an MSc from the London School of Economics and Political Science, and has undertaken graduate studies in international law and development-focused policy. She has completed specialist training in cybersecurity, governance, risk and compliance, mediation, negotiation, and child protection.
She regularly designs and delivers training programmes, workshops, and policy engagements across Africa and internationally, working with regulators, schools, civil society organisations, and industry stakeholders to promote safe, responsible, and rights-respecting use of technology.
